Seite 1 von 1

angepasstes Überschriftenformat im Inhaltsverzeichnis überne

Verfasst: Fr 6. Aug 2010, 22:00
von K2P
Hallo ich habe vom Lehrstuhl strenge Formatvorlagen für die Überschriften erhalten und diese sollen genau in diesem Format dann auch im Inhaltsverzeichnis angezeigt werden.
Die Chapter und Sections sollen in Größe 12 und fett dargestellt werden,
die Subsections in Größe 12 und kursiv und die Subsubsections als ganz normaler Text in 12.
Durch die Befehle unten habe ich das auch hinbekommen, nur werden die neuen Formate nicht ins Inhaltsverzeichnis übernommen, jediglich die Schriftart (Times) und die Schriftgröße von 12 stimmt. die Sections werden jedoch nicht fett und die Subsections nicht kursiv angezeigt....



Weiss jemand wie ich diese Format in das Inhaltsverzeichnis bekomme?

[
\usepackage{tocstyle}
\usetocstyle{allwithdot}

\addtokomafont{disposition}{\rmfamily} % Schriftart Times in den Überschriften
\chapterheadstartvskip

\setkomafont{chapter}{\normalsize}   %fett,normal
\setkomafont{section}{\normalsize}    %fett,normal
\setkomafont{subsection}{\normalsize\mdseries\itshape}   %kursiv, normal
\setkomafont{subsubsection}{\normalsize\mdseries}           %normal

\renewcommand*\thechapter{\Roman{chapter}}

\renewcommand*\thesubsection{\alph{subsection}}

\renewcommand*\thesubsubsection{\alph{subsubsection}}

Re: angepasstes Überschriftenformat im Inhaltsverzeichnis üb

Verfasst: Fr 6. Aug 2010, 22:14
von Stefan Kottwitz
Hallo,
K2P hat geschrieben:die Sections werden jedoch nicht fett und die Subsections nicht kursiv angezeigt....
erweitere die Formatzuweisung:
\setkomafont{section}{\normalsize\bfseries}
K2P hat geschrieben:Weiss jemand wie ich diese Format in das Inhaltsverzeichnis bekomme?
Das geht auch mit \setkomafont, die entsprechenden Elemente heißen chapterentry und sectionentry.

Stefan

Verfasst: Fr 6. Aug 2010, 22:27
von K2P
Hallo, danke für die schnelle Antwort.

Ich bekomme das mit chapterentry und sectionentry einfach nicht hin.
Kannst du mir mal einen kompletten Befehl für z.B. die Übernahme des Formats der subsection schreiben?

Vielen Dank und Sorry, ich bin absoluter Latex- und Komaneuling

Verfasst: Fr 6. Aug 2010, 22:42
von Stefan Kottwitz
Beispielsweise kann man den Schrifttyp so übernehmen:
\setkomafont{chapterentry}{\usekomafont{chapter}}
\setkomafont{sectionentry}{\usekomafont{section}}
Oder man setzt sie ausführlich:
\setkomafont{sectionentry}{\normalsize\bfseries}
Stefan

Verfasst: Fr 6. Aug 2010, 22:51
von K2P
Leider kommt bei dem sectionentry Befehl, cannot be set....

Gibt es keinen einfach Befehl, der die Formatierung aus den Überschriften ganz einfach in das Inhaltverzeichnis übernimmt? Die Überschrifte (bis subsubsection) werden im Text alle richtig angezeigt...

Verfasst: Fr 6. Aug 2010, 23:10
von Stefan Kottwitz
K2P hat geschrieben:Leider kommt bei dem sectionentry Befehl, cannot be set...
Stimmt, den gibt es bei scrartcl jedoch nicht bei scrreprt und scrbook. :roll:

Das verkompliziert die Umsetzung etwas. Doch da Du schon tocstyle lädst, kannst Du dessen features verwenden:
\settocfeature[toc][0]{entryhook}{\usekomafont{chapter}}
\settocfeature[toc][1]{entryhook}{\usekomafont{section}}
Stefan

Verfasst: Fr 6. Aug 2010, 23:17
von K2P
Durch die obigen Befehle hat er jetzt die ganze Formatierung aus dem Inhaltsverzeichnis genommen...

Vorher war wenigstens die chapters noch fettgedruckt, jetzt ist alles einfach Schrift (wie der Textkörper)

tocstyle

Verfasst: Fr 6. Aug 2010, 23:22
von Stefan Kottwitz
Hier sind die Einträge fett:
\documentclass{scrbook}
\usepackage{tocstyle}
\usetocstyle{allwithdot} 
\addtokomafont{disposition}{\rmfamily}
\setkomafont{chapter}{\normalsize\bfseries}
\setkomafont{section}{\normalsize\bfseries}
\setkomafont{chapterentry}{\usekomafont{chapter}}
\settocfeature[toc][0]{entryhook}{\usekomafont{chapter}}
\settocfeature[toc][1]{entryhook}{\usekomafont{section}}
\begin{document}
\tableofcontents
\chapter{Testkapitel}
\section{Testabschnitt}
\end{document}
Stefan

Verfasst: Fr 6. Aug 2010, 23:29
von K2P
Durch diese Kombination habe ich es jetzt geschafft....
\setkomafont{chapter}{\normalsize\bfseries}  %fett,normal
\setkomafont{section}{\normalsize\bfseries}    %fett,normal
\setkomafont{subsection}{\normalsize\mdseries\itshape}   %kursiv, normal
\setkomafont{subsubsection}{\normalsize\mdseries}           %normal

\settocfeature[toc][0]{entryhook}{\usekomafont{chapter}} 
\settocfeature[toc][1]{entryhook}{\usekomafont{section}}
\settocfeature[toc][2]{entryhook}{\usekomafont{subsection}}
\settocfeature[toc][3]{entryhook}{\usekomafont{subsubsection}}
Vielen Vielen Dank!!!!!